How to dry hawthorn and how to eat it after drying

1. How to dry

1. Select hawthorn: When the hawthorn is ripe, you can pick it yourself, or you can choose and buy good hawthorn. The hawthorn should be undamaged, plump, and free from diseases and pests.

2. Clean: Pick out fresh hawthorns and wash them in clean water. Wash them at least 2-3 times until they are clean. After washing, take it out and place it in a well-ventilated place to drain the moisture.

3. Slice and remove seeds: Cut the hawthorn into 3-4 slices. Larger hawthorns can be cut into 4 slices, and small ones can be cut into three slices. Be careful when cutting so as not to hurt your hands. The middle slice will contain hawthorn seeds, which can be kept or removed by hand or with chopsticks.

4. Drying: If you have bamboo sticks at home, you can thread the silk thread onto the bamboo sticks, tie them up and place them in a cool place to dry. You can also prepare a large container, place the hawthorns one by one on it, and turn them over from time to time. Turn them over once every half a day at the beginning, and then once a day. After drying, you can collect them and eat them slowly.

2. How to eat after drying

After hawthorn is dried, it can be soaked in water and drunk. It is quite convenient and good for the body. First, soak it in a small amount of water to remove dust, then add water and soak it before drinking.
